Desativando um jToggleButton [duplicado]
Esta pergunta já tem uma resposta aqui:
Desabilitar um jToggleButton durante toda a execução, é possível? [fechadas] 1 respostaEi pessoal, estou criando esse sistema simples de bilhetagem de filmes. O fluxo do meu programa é o seguinte e todas as páginas estão em JFrames diferentes: Menu principal> Escolha dia> Selecionar filme> selecione filme> selecione assento> de volta ao MainMenu
estou a usarJToggle
no seletor de assento. É possível desativar o botão de alternância durante toda a execução, uma vez selecionado? estou a usarJToggleButton.setEnabled(false);
mas sempre que volto ao menu e volto ao seletor de lugar, o botão ainda não está desativado. o que eu quero fazer é desativá-lo mesmo depois de voltar ao MainMenu; não pode mais selecionar este lugar.
Abaixo estão alguns códigos:
private void jButton2ActionPerformed(java.awt.event.ActionEvent evt) {
// TODO add your handling code here:
this.setVisible(false);
MainSelection s = new MainSelection();
s.setVisible(true);
if(jToggleButton1.isSelected())
{
jToggleButton1.setEnabled(false);
}
if(jToggleButton2.isSelected())
{
jToggleButton2.setEnabled(false);
}
if(jToggleButton3.isSelected())
{
jToggleButton3.setEnabled(false);
}
}
Por favor, confira